Situations Where Full Service Help Pays Off

Not every move needs full service help, but some everyday situations really do benefit from it. Think about times when you’re managing more than just stuff, you’re also managing people, schedules, and access issues.

  • Large family moves, especially from other states, take coordination that goes beyond packing tape.
  • Apartment moves downtown often involve stairs, traffic, or strict building rules that stall things fast.
  • Seniors, busy parents, or anyone with limited mobility may find it safer and simpler not to lift or carry at all.

When everyone’s physical energy or emotional capacity is already low, handing off the hard parts is a practical choice. It’s not about avoiding responsibility. It’s about being able to focus on getting settled, instead of running on empty.

What Full Service Movers Actually Do

Sometimes people hear “full service” and imagine it means gold-plated boxes or luxury extras. Most of the time, it just means someone else is handling the logistics while you handle everything else.

  • Packing supplies, bubble wrap, and sturdy boxes are usually included or brought during the job.
  • Movers wrap breakables, take apart furniture, label everything, and reassemble what’s needed at the new place.
  • Some services offer storage or flexible scheduling, especially when things don’t line up perfectly between one place and the next.

What matters most in summer is keeping everything moving. When time is short and the sun’s high, having fast, experienced help makes a real difference in getting through the day.
